About N-methyl-5-propan-2-ylpyrimidin-4-amine

N-methyl-5-propan-2-ylpyrimidin-4-amine (PubChem CID 45095843) has the molecular formula C8H13N3 and a molecular weight of 151.21 g/mol. Its IUPAC name is N-methyl-5-propan-2-ylpyrimidin-4-amine.
